Vitamin B12 helps your body use fat and carbohydrates for energy and make new protein ... patricia e. bathWebThe Vitamin B12 injection is an effective way to treat a deficiency. There is only one type of vitamin B12 injection available in the UK, known as hydroxocobalamin. Vitamin B12 tablets, also known as cyanocobalamin, can be bought over the counter from pharmacies or health stores, but are not as effective as the injection. ... patricia eberharter npWebSep 25, 2024 · B12 Injection Side Effects Injection Site Reactions. Upon receiving the B12 injection, you may experience a skin reaction in or around the area in which the injection was placed. Pain, redness, and swelling may occur shortly after the procedure is complete.
